Kinnettles Castle, Hotel, and Mansion Portfolio in Scotland Listed for Sale at £15 Million

  • Justine Noble
  • 17 April 2026
🏠 Kinnettles Castle, a historic estate in Scotland, hits the market for £15 million, offering individual and group sales. Located on a 58-acre plot, it features 11 bedrooms, a coach house with 8 more rooms, and a 140-cover marquee. Built in 1870, the estate includes a two-bedroom gate lodge and is near St Andrews' famous golf courses. Owned since 2016 by a private investor, the property is a rare investment opportunity.

MCR Property Group Invests £150m in London Hospitality Platform, Plans to Expand Portfolio to £500m

  • Justine Noble
  • 16 April 2026
🏨 MCR Property Group has invested £150 million in a new London-based hospitality platform, acquiring a portfolio for £123 million in Kensington and Chelsea, aiming to scale to £500 million. The portfolio includes Ashburn Hotel, Ashburn Court, Chesham Court, and Claverley Court, offering boutique hotel rooms and serviced apartments. The initiative led by Edmund Kissner involves a full refurbishment to create a cohesive brand. Founder Aneel Mussarat plans further acquisitions across the UK to optimize income growth.

Angus Land Company Proposes £480m Hyatt Hotel and Resort Project with Golf and Housing in Scotland

  • Justine Noble
  • 8 April 2026
🏨 Angus Land Company Ltd proposed a £480m mixed-use hotel and resort project in Wellbank, Scotland. Spanning 310 acres, it includes a 450-room Hyatt hotel, IMG golf facilities, and 185 residential plots. Public consultations are on 27 April and 3 June, with Mocca Capital and Castle Properties involved. The project aims to create substantial job opportunities and support the local economy by integrating luxury hospitality and residences with training facilities for the tourism industry.

Leonardo Hotels Acquires Hotel Saint in London Aldgate, Adding 11th Property in Capital to Portfolio

  • Justine Noble
  • 7 April 2026
🏨 Leonardo Hotels acquired Hotel Saint in London's Aldgate, marking their 11th property in the city. The 272-room hotel will be rebranded as Leonardo Hotel London Aldgate, featuring free Wi-Fi, workspaces, and city-view rooms. Dining options include The Cardinal Bar and Kitchen and Jin Bo Law rooftop bar. The hotel offers a gym and five meeting rooms for up to 80 people. This acquisition supports Fattal Hotels' UK and Ireland expansion, comprising 60 properties with over 11,000 rooms.

Marriott Forms Joint Venture with Leali Family to Expand Luxury Wellness Brand Lefay Internationally

  • Justine Noble
  • 31 March 2026
🏨 Marriott International and the Leali family announced a joint venture to integrate Lefay, founded in Italy in 2006, into Marriott's portfolio. Lefay operates eco-resorts with a focus on wellness, including locations in Lago di Garda and Dolomiti, Italy. New resorts are planned in Tuscany, Southern Italy, and the Swiss Alps. Marriott aims to expand Lefay's presence internationally, preserving its identity while growing its luxury wellness offerings.
